Review of Halloween
My personal favorite, this movie could be considered the first real slasher flick as it predates a great many horror franchises. This John Carpenter and Debra Hill collaboration was once the highest grossing independant film in history, and spawned seven sequels, six with notorious serial killer Michael Myers as the villain. Donald Pleasance stars in the best role of his career as Michael's psychiatrist Dr. Sam Loomis, the only man who knows how evil Michael is. This classic thriller was also responsible for the launch of Jamie Lee Curtis as a star in the horror genre. Setting the standard for what horror should be, Halloween is a movie that no horror fan should live without.

In terms of pure shock value, this is the scariest movie ever made. I had about 12 heart attacks watching this movie; every scare is timed PERFECTLY. Most horror movies are extremely lucky to get 4 good scares in them, this one had at least triple that. The closest thing to it would be Evil Dead, which had around 8 good jump scares, Candyman, which had about 7, and Nightmare on Elm Street which had about 5. It won't give you nightmares like Jacob's Ladder(the primary inspiration for Silent Hill), have you up all night with the lights on waiting for ghost(see The Eye), and it doesn't have atmosphere that will make your skin crawl like The Shining or Session 9. In fact I laughed off all the scares as soon as the movie was done. However, for 90 minutes you are going to be jumping out of your seat every 5 minutes. It's a shame John Carpenter never came remotely close to matching this movie. The Fog had maybe 4 good scares, In the Mouth of Madness had maybe 3, and Christine had one. Dunno how he earned the title of "Master of Suspense" with this movie alone, especially considering Wes Craven and Dario Argento both did at least a dozen good horror movies each and George Romero boasts a lot more good horrors than Carpenter. Still, the original Halloween is a fucking masterpiece. Any horror director worth his salt should be timing every suspense build-up and scare in this movie with a stopwatch.
